Claw-hammer

Claw-hammer is a method of playing the five-string banjo. Unlike Scruggs style, in which strings are picked individually using the thumb, index and middle fingers, in clawhammer playing the melody string is picked with the index finger, followed by a strum using the second, third and fourth fingers, after which the fifth (upper G) string is picked using the thumb.
